Key QuotesWind Turbine NoiseWind Farm Noise Guideline, Noise Measurement Services Pty Ltd., March, 2011New Zealand“Wind has audible and sub-audible character. That is, measurement of wind sound willalways present sound levels in the audible, low-frequency and infrasonic frequencies.Adverse health effects are due to extreme psychological stress from environmentalnoise, particularly low frequency noise with symptoms of sleep disturbance, headache,tinnitus, ear pressure, dizziness, vertigo, nausea, visual blurring, tachycardia, irritability,problems with concentration and memory, and panic attack episodes associated withsensations of internal pulsations when awake or asleep. Sound in the low frequenciescan be heard at relatively lower levels of “loudness”. The research documented in thisGuideline indicates “ordinary” wind has a laminar or smooth infrasound and lowfrequencyflow pattern when analyzed over short periods of time. Wind farm activityappears to create a “pulsing” infrasound and low-frequency pattern…The hypothesesderived from professional research reported here is that wind farm noise has anadverse effect on susceptible individuals due to these pressure variations as well asaudible noise due to the wind turbines. These effects may be cumulative.”
